Address 0 DOGE

DLr4ske5SX7evmjf31chxPcsTJkVzeCbqU

Confirmed

Total Received349910.81 DOGE
Total Sent349910.81 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

DLr4ske5SX7evmjf31chxPcsTJkVzeCbqU349910.81 DOGE
Fee: 1 DOGE
3897892 Confirmations349909.81 DOGE
DLr4ske5SX7evmjf31chxPcsTJkVzeCbqU349910.81 DOGE
D5ofgE4GJqZqMR9sx8x5UCwd8g4Pof2LxY10088.19 DOGE
Fee: 1 DOGE
3897901 Confirmations359999 DOGE